Based on the universal polymeric reversed-phase Oasis LHB sorbent, this cartridge is 6 cc and designed for extraction across a wide range of acidic, basic, and neutral compounds from various matrices. This is done using a simple and generic protocol. The 60 µm particle size is recommended for work with viscous samples and can be paired with lab equipment and kits like the Carbamate Analysis Kit.
Oasis HLB is a hydrophilic-lipophilic-balanced, reversed-phase sorbent designed to meet a range of SPE needs. The sorbent is made from a specific ratio of two monomers, hydrophilic N-vinylpyrrolidone and lipophilic divinylbenzene, making it water-wettable. Due to the water-wettable nature of Oasis HLB sorbent, these cartridges offer a capability of higher retention and excellent recoveries, even when the sorbent runs dry, preventing the need for extraordinary steps to keep sorbent beds from becoming dry during the period prior to sample loading. Additionally, this unique substrate offers stability at extreme pH and across a wide range of solvents, extraordinary retention of polar compounds, and a relatively high hydrophobic retention capacity when compared to traditional silica-based sorbents.
This product includes 30 cartridges with a 150 mg capacity each. The cartridges are a syringe-barrel style, designed for use with vacuum manifolds and automated SPE instruments.

How Should I Pre-Treat Biological Samples for Use with Oasis HLB Cartridges?
These recommendations are for preparing samples prior to solid-phase extraction. When using biological samples such as plasma, serum, or urine, you should first prepare acidified or basified water diluents. If you are working with plasma or urine, dilute 1:1 with acidified or basified water, then add between 10 and 50 µL of internal standard. The final concentration should be no more than 10% organic; otherwise, protein precipitation can occur and polar compound retention may be compromised. If necessary, you can clarify samples by centrifugation at 8000 x g for between 10 and 20 minutes.
